Term Life Insurance vs Whole Life Insurance

When you’re looking for life insurance in Grand Forks, ND, you’ll come across two main types: term life insurance and whole life insurance. They each have their own set of features and benefits, so it’s important to understand the difference between the two before making a decision.

Term life insurance is the most basic type of life insurance. It provides coverage for a specific period of time, typically 10-30 years. If you die during that time frame, your beneficiaries will receive a death benefit. If you don’t die during the term, the policy expires and you won’t get anything back.

Whole life insurance is a more comprehensive type of life insurance that provides coverage for your entire life. As long as you pay your premiums, your beneficiaries will receive a death benefit when you die. Whole life insurance also has a cash value component, which means it can grow over time and be used as a source of financial security in retirement or during other periods of need.

North Dakota law does not require life insurance companies to offer both types of coverage, but most companies do offer both term and whole life insurance. When shopping for life insurance in Grand Forks, ND, it’s important to compare the features and benefits of each type of policy to find the one that best meets your needs.

Medical Exam vs No Medical Exam in Grand Forks, ND

When you apply for life insurance, the insurer will want to assess your risk of dying prematurely. One way they do this is by requiring a medical exam. This involves a doctor collecting information about your health history and current health status.

If you don’t want to go through a medical exam, you can still get life insurance, but it will be more expensive because you’re considered a higher risk. There are also some “no medical exam” life insurance policies available that don’t require a medical exam, but these typically have lower death benefits and are more expensive than policies that do require a medical exam.
